Post Quantum Cryptography Pqc Standardization 2025 Update Post quantum cryptography (pqc) refers to cryptographic algorithms (primarily public key algorithms) designed to be secure against an attack by a future quantum computer. the motivation for pqc is the threat that large scale quantum computers pose to current cryptographic systems.
